Remove CSS and Javascript templates from the templates list selector and place both editors below the HTML template editor box

      These options are used by advanced or technical users, that will make use of them while editing the template from the code editor, so there is no point to display such as technical options for all users (advanced or non-experienced ones) all the time in the templates list.

      CSS and Javascript templates are actually applying to all templates (Add entry, Single view, List view and Advanced search), so it make sense to move these two elements below the template HTML/code editor, under a new accordion component called 'Advanced code tools'. This way, users that make use of this feature will be able to access it from all the templates.

      This relocation will also help to reduce the complex concept our users have about Database activities.
